FIFA 11 is the yearly, best selling football (soccer) game by EA Sports. FIFA 11 features 11 v 11 online multiplayer and the ability to play as a goalkeeper.

It's kind of REEEALLY confusing lol "Let me help you out here, each country has various divisions, example: the Premier league is the top division in England followed by the Championships. Each year when these divisions play they get points on how they performed, usually, a win is 3 points, a draw is 1 point and no points for a loss. As long as they stay out of the bottom 3 of their division they are safe, if they are however in the bottom 3 they get relegated to the lower division while the top 2 teams from the lower divisions are automatically promoted while teams 3-6 in the table are in the playoffs and one of them gets promoted along with the top 2.
There are other tournaments in a season aswell like the Champions League which is probably the biggest of all of these as the best teams from all over Europe participate. All teams who finish 1st in their country's table get automatic qualification while the teams who finish 2nd - 4th have to play qualifiers.
Hopefully thats enough information to get you started for now, if you're having trouble picking a team to support I think you should watch some top division football from a few countries and see which team's playing style you like best.

@cjmabry:
You have the English Premier League, Serie A, La Liga, and Bundesliga. These are the top leagues in Europe. Respectively, England, Italy, Spain, and Germany. Each league consists of 20 teams. Each team plays 38 games a season. Each team plays each other team twice-once home and once away(The Bundelisga is an exception; it consists of 18 teams and thus 34 games are played by each team in a season). The team with the most points (3-win, 1-draw, 0-loss) wins "the League". On top of this, there is a domestic competition. A tournament in each respective league. Mostly people don't care about their domestic competition, and they use those games to rest their main players.
On top of all this there are two UEFA torunaments: The Champions league, and the UEFA Europa League. The Champions League (CL) is the most important tournament teams will play in. It spans across all Europe. The winner of the CL is deemed the best team in Europe. To get into the CL you need to qualify from the previous domestic season. Each League has a different amount of "spots" in the Champions league. The English, Italian, and Spanish league have 3 spots, while the German has 2. So if one year Manchester United, Chelsea, and Arsenal finish in the top 3 in the English Premier League (EPL) last year, this year they are all qualified for the CL. The FOURTH team in the EPL plays in a qualifying round to try and get into the CL. This is the same with the Spanish League and Italian League. The German League, since it only has two spots available, the third team enters the qualifying round.
The UEFA Europa League is the "lesser" Champions League. It is played by the teams that finish 4-6 in their respective leagues. It follows the same format. Also if a team falls out of the CL early, they automatically go into the Europa League. The Europa League, while prestigious, is not really cared about. Almost all attention is paid to the CL or the respective leagues. The Champions League final, usually played at the end of the regular season, in late may. (Last year was on May 22nd). The Champions League final is the closest "game" you will find to the Super Bowl. The number of viewers are close, I believe the CL final has more though.
